Canadian Aboriginal People who meet all entry requirements will be given priority for up to 15% of the seats available.
First Priority: Manitobans
Graduates of the universities of Manitoba who are Canadian Citizens or Permanent Residents and Manitoba residents who are graduates of out-of-province universities.
Second Priority:
Other Canadian Applicants Canadians Citizens or Permanent Residents who are residents of Canadian provinces or territories other than Manitoba. Each year, approximately 15% of the class is selected from this group.
Third Priority: International Applicants
International applicants who are graduates of universities recognized by the University of Manitoba and who hold appropriate visa status.
Important Note: Up to 15% of spots will be held for competitive out-of-province applicants within the first 50 letters of offer. Once the first 50 offers are sent out, all other applicants (Manitoban, Other Canadian, and International) are placed on an alternate list based on overall score regardless of residency.
